The Scanner 2000 steam mass flow transmitter takes its inputs
from a primary flowmeter, (Gilflo or ILVA) through impulse lines. It
converts the differential and static pressure into a corrected mass
flowrate of saturated steam, which is accessible via the RS485
Modbus link or optionally via a 4 - 20 mA signal.
Scanner 2000 steam mass flow transmitters are uniquely
configured at the factory to work with a single, specific Gilflo or
ILVA flowmeter, for a specific flow application.
For correct operation the Scanner 2000 transmitter must be
installed with its allocated flowmeter. A label on the packaging
gives the serial number of the matched product.
The Scanner 2000 can be configured using an RS485 equipped
PC with the supplied configuration software.
Note: A DB9 Serial RS232 to RS485 converter will otherwise be
required to connect your PC to the Scanner 2000.
If your PC only has USB ports a USB to DB9 Serial port converter
will be required. These are available from most electronic
equipment suppliers.
